Transaction 06bbd88c709953ecf3d23d8062d259997a76fcb137b856c393e6619b9224f196

1 Input
2 Outputs
  • 06bbd88c709953ecf3d23d8062d259997a76fcb137b856c393e6619b9224f196:0
  • value  1900000
    address  3PEPRigFNjhoAjdn1w9obocHU46KRwcgHQ
  • 06bbd88c709953ecf3d23d8062d259997a76fcb137b856c393e6619b9224f196:1
  • value  298050000
    address  1Cyhu88svQMzT5LTR4ThDzvveUL14gb8Kj